Matt and Natalie’s Wedding

June 12th, 2008

I recently had the pleasure of photographing Matt and Natalie’s wedding day.  It was held in Geelong and Torquay, where Matt grew up.   The clouds were hovering overhead for most of the day, but thankfully, the rain held out.  

I think we made the most of the dim lighting during the afternoon by selecting fantastic locations to contrast the couple with.  The pier was a photographers dream. The water was still and provided a soft backdrop for our shots.  We also made an unplanned stop at a dirt road along the highway, which provided a true  ”Aussie countryside” setting, with a horse stealing the show. And we made it to the beach as the sun set into the horizon for a great end to the day.
